<<Disclaimer: Verify this information before applying it to your situation.>>

Wish I had more concrete answers.................I received TONS of
responses, most from people who are also curious as to why these
wonderful treats would contain gluten.

I have verified that they are made in their own cup with GF Ice cream
and mixed with the same spoon they serve it with.  Some had questioned
weather M&M's won't GUARANTEE that they are GF since the crispy m&m's
may be made on the same production line........which then forced
McDonald's not to guarantee their product.

A few suggested that because the Oreo crumbs are kept in close
proximity, there may be a cross contamination issue at McDonald's.

Quite a few people have told me they eat them with no problems.

I guess we'll each have to weigh the odds on this one.  It would be so
sad to think yet another choice is taken away from us!!!
